Or just consider some HTTP over TLS proxy like this one: https://github.com/Snawoot/dumbproxy
It may appear a bit more flexible option, especially if forwarding all traffic to VPN entirely is undesirable.

Spin up secure HTTPS proxy in less than 10 minutes
[Unit] Description=Dumb Proxy Documentation=https://github.com/Snawoot/dumbproxy/ After=network.target network-online.target Requires=network-online.target [Service] EnvironmentFile=/etc/default/dumbproxy User=root Group=root ExecStart=/usr/local/bin/dumbproxy $OPTIONS TimeoutStopSec=5s PrivateTmp=true ProtectSystem=full LimitNOFILE=20000 [Install] WantedBy=default.target
